Soldier Boy would also like to show off one of his tattoo's...he didn't want to feel left out. 

'Why would I get a tattoo of an ammo belt around my thigh...? Well first, I like to place tattoos where a person can't see them while I am wearing shorts or a shirt. Second, I don't know many people with a ammo belt tattoo around their thigh.  

During my first two deployments overseas, I was a gunner for our trucks.  I operated a machine gun and my second deployment I had a machine gun as a personal weapon.  Army lingo: M240B and my personal one that I carried was a M249 (SAW).  So when I got back from my second deployment I wanted something to symbolize my accomplishment of lugging around the weapon and all the bullets that went with it. 4 days before I was on an airplane heading to the middle east for the 3rd time I tattooed the ammo belt on my left thigh. Once again I found myself gunning for the trucks and doing my job.  To me it was a symbol of protection and having a weapon that can lay down an awesome base of fire when the time was needed.  My buddies always joked, saying, "Ward has extra ammo around his leg if we need it."'
